Agriculture is arguably the world's most important sector and agriculture is under intense pressure from multiple fronts. Sustainability, land use, fresh water shortages, growing population, climate uncertainty, carbon emissions, etc.
Agriculture needs rapid technology innovation and adoption. Small, medium and local producers face an increasing need to shift to accessible automation in order to survive.
M-ACRE was formed to help accelerate innovation, deployment, and adoption of robotics and technology by reducing cost, technical challenges and skill gaps. Users and innovators hit a wall when their idea requires high capital costs before they can even test a concept.
Capital cost and implementation risk is a barrier to not only farmers, producers, but also for users who want to try or test technology before investing in a solution and customizing it to work for them.
The equipment cost presents a impossible hurdle to most entrepreneurs, startups and innovators who want to test a concept or bootstrap a prototype before seeking outside investments and early stage venture capital. Atlantic Canada has a highly skilled and educated work force and a strong entrepreneurial and start-up ecosystem. However, most new startups are limited to software, data collection, AI, retail, etc.. not by skill, ambition, or need, but by the cost of admission.
Robots, automation, and technology acquisitions are expensive.
M-ACRE can help.
M-ACRE allows members to pool and share resources that all members can use to develop, test, and prototype their own incremental solutions.
Most robotics and automation solutions today share common hardware, software, and controls, which M-ACRE can provide.

Our community can use the pool of shared hardware to conduct research, develop proof of concepts and build minimum viable products that they can then leverage to launch new products, secure funding, or kick-start new companies.
M-ACRE has volunteer mentors with industry, academic and business experience. These mentors want to help as they can. If members want more help, they are free to negotiate paid services or partnerships amoung themselves which M-ACRE can help facilitate.
M-ACRE is a non-for-profit co-operative and therefore we do not do anything without the support of our membership. All members have a voice in how M-ACRE operates, but always within the confines of a non-profit co-operative and always with the intent to further the goals and values of the co-operative. We do not and will not own, share, or use proprietary IP development by our members unless explicitly permitted to do so. The co-operative owns equipment and provides common services that our members can use.
